Confiscated Gold: No Suit in USA

An American company pays for gold, but it is confiscated in Kenya, and the company seeks to cover its loss in a United States court. The Foreign Sovereign Immunities Act protects Kenya by withholding subject-matter jurisdiction, the United States Court of Appeals for the Eighth Circuit explained in the matter Community Finance Group v. Republic of Kenya, docket number 11-1816, December 15, 2011. -- Clemens Kochinke, partner, Berliner, Corcoran & Rowe, LLP, Washington, DC.
